Just Eat's Countdown Club recently opened its doors in Munich, dialing up the excitement for fans, influencers and media partners leading up to the UEFA Champions League Final. This season is Just Eat's fourth season sponsoring the UEFA Champions League and its men's and women's club competitions, and the Countdown Club further supports the football community in Germany.
The Countdown Club officially opened May 28th and will remain open until the end of the month so that fans can come together and celebrate Europe's biggest football event. On-site, visitors will be treated to panel talks, exclusive merch drops, deliveries from fan-favorite food spots, plus the chance to win tickets to the Champions League Final.
